    "Smooth", that word is gross to me.

    If you want real jazz that is quiet, AND still good, try getting the Dexter Gordon album called Ballads. If you need more music, get the Stan Getz For Lovers collection, and Ben Webster's Soulville album.

    If you have any jazz fans at your reception, they might jump out the windows if Kenny G is playing.
